Mp Queries Measures On ‘wanted’ Al-rajaan
MP Mehalhal Al-Mudaf forwarded queries to Minister of Interior Sheikh Thamer Ali Al-Sabah about the decision to lift the travel ban imposed on former Director General of the Public Institution for Social Security (PIFSS) Fahd Al-Rajaan. He requested for a copy of the decision. The lawmaker wants to know the measures taken against those behind the decision, legal basis for taking such a decision, and steps that will be taken for Al- Rajaan to return to the country in order to stand trial and to recover the money he stole.
MP Hesham Al-Saleh has submitted a bill on transferring the Criminal Investigations General Department and Forensic Medicine General Department from the Ministry of Interior to the Ministry of Justice. Article Two of the bill gives the minister of justice the right to supervise and monitor the Public Prosecution, Criminal Investigations General Department and Forensic Medicine General Department.
It stipulates that these two general departments are under the public prosecutor who exercises the authorities granted to him according to Law No. 23/1990. Employees in these general departments, including doctors, technicians and administrative staff will occupy similar posts at the Ministry of Justice while their respective seniority levels will be retained. Al-Saleh explained that the bill is aimed at ensuring justice for all.
He pointed out that since the supporting institutions involved in work related to justice, they have to be affiliated to the Ministry of Justice. MPs Abdullah Al-Turaiji, Mubarak Al-Arow, Ahmed Al- Hamad, Saif Al-Harshani and Salman Al-Azmi submitted a bill on granting two years full time vacation to civil and military athlete workers for them to engage in sports in the country or abroad. The bill stipulates amending Sports Law No. 87/2017, particularly replacing Article 17 with the following paragraph: “The Board of Directors of the Public Authority for Sports (PAS) has the right to grant maximum two years vacation to athletes working in public institutions, military institutions and companies in which the State owns more than 50 percent of the capital; in addition to those in military conscription, as per the request of the concerned sports club.”
Also, a new article will be added on granting the employees who meet the conditions stipulated in this law; including athletes, doctors, technicians, administrative staff and natural therapy practitioners, the right to request to be delegated or seconded to PAS without any effect on their allowances and privileges. In another development, MP Hamad Al-Matar posted a picture of him accompanying former MPs Salem Al-Namlan, Mubarak Al- Waalan and Mubarak Al- Herbesh on their flight back home from Turkey. These three former MPs are among the beneficiaries of the Amiri amnesty granted to some of those convicted in the National Assembly building storming and Abdally Cell cases.
